On Wed, Apr 29, 2009 at 9:56 AM, Jeff Layton <[email protected]> wrote: > On Wed, 29 Apr 2009 09:39:58 -0500 > Shirish Pargaonkar <[email protected]> wrote: > >> On Wed, Apr 29, 2009 at 9:12 AM, Jeff Layton <[email protected]> wrote: >> > On Wed, 29 Apr 2009 08:58:22 -0500 >> > Shirish Pargaonkar <[email protected]> wrote: >> > >> >> On Wed, Apr 29, 2009 at 8:29 AM, Jeff Layton <[email protected]> wrote: >> >> > It's possible to have the null terminator for a charset be a single or >> >> > multiple character. Add a function to tell us how long it should be. >> >> > >> >> > Signed-off-by: Jeff Layton <[email protected]> >> >> > --- >> >> > fs/cifs/cifs_unicode.h | 19 +++++++++++++++++++ >> >> > 1 files changed, 19 insertions(+), 0 deletions(-) >> >> > >> >> > diff --git a/fs/cifs/cifs_unicode.h b/fs/cifs/cifs_unicode.h >> >> > index 14eb9a2..6bffab5 100644 >> >> > --- a/fs/cifs/cifs_unicode.h >> >> > +++ b/fs/cifs/cifs_unicode.h >> >> > @@ -64,6 +64,25 @@ int cifs_strtoUCS(__le16 *, const char *, int, const struct nls_table *); >> >> > #endif >> >> > >> >> > /* >> >> > + * null_charlen - return length of null character for codepage >> >> > + * @codepage - codepage for which to return length of NULL terminator >> >> > + * >> >> > + * Since we can't guarantee that the null terminator will be a particular >> >> > + * length, we have to check against the codepage. If there's a problem >> >> > + * determining it, assume a single-byte NULL terminator. >> >> > + */ >> >> > +static inline int >> >> > +null_charlen(const struct nls_table *codepage) >> >> > +{ >> >> > + int charlen; >> >> > + char tmp[NLS_MAX_CHARSET_SIZE]; >> >> > + >> >> > + charlen = codepage->uni2char(0, tmp, NLS_MAX_CHARSET_SIZE); >> >> > + >> >> > + return charlen > 0 ? charlen : 1; >> >> > +} >> >> > + >> >> > +/* >> >> > * UniStrcat: Concatenate the second string to the first >> >> > * >> >> > * Returns: >> >> > -- >> >> > 1.6.0.6 >> >> > >> >> > _______________________________________________ >> >> > linux-cifs-client mailing list >> >> > [email protected] >> >> > https://lists.samba.org/mailman/listinfo/linux-cifs-client >> >> > >> >> >> >> For some of the charsets I looked at under fs/nls, it looks like uni2char >> >> always returns 1, I think to indicate the function succeeded as opposed >> >> to sending an error. >> >> Are there any charsets that you might have looked at whose >> >> uni2char function returns more than 1 byte as size of the null character? >> > >> > No, I haven't see any, but I didn't do an exhaustive search. Given the >> > number of problems we've had in this area, I'm leery of making any >> > assumptions about these lengths. It's also possible that at some point >> > in the future we could have an in-kernel version of UTF-16 or UTF-32. >> > In the event of that we'll need to deal with multibyte null termination. >> > >> > So I think it makes sense to use a helper function for determining this >> > rather than sprinkling "+1" to lengths all over the code. The overhead >> > looks pretty minimal anyway. >> > >> > -- >> > Jeff Layton <[email protected]> >> > >> >> Jeff, I do not think uni2char returns the lenght of a character is bytes. > > Yes, it does. Alright but the reason I had doubt was, even char2uni returns 1, now that is not correct when a code point from a charset is mapped/encoded to a mutlibyte code value using UTF-16. > >> But what you are saying as I understand is, in the future null_charlen may >> call some other function than uni2char to get the size of a null character >> to get an accurate value, so interface will remain same, just the functionility >> (of null_charlen) may change. > > Correct. We could (in principle) make that just return 1 for now, but > then we'd have to worry about fixing that in the future if a multibyte > null terminator were ever needed. > > -- > Jeff Layton <[email protected]> >
